Design the Discovery Research Plan

This activity helps you decide: Which questions need interviews, observation, usability testing, analytics, surveys, or live-product evidence?

Typical output: Mass Product Research Plan

What this activity covers

Choose the right research methods based on scale, risk, timeline, and user accessibility.

Why it matters

Do not choose methods because they are familiar. Choose them because they fit the decision and the evidence source.

Typical output

Mass Product Research Plan

Questions this activity helps answer
  • Which questions need interviews, observation, usability testing, analytics, surveys, or live-product evidence?
  • What can be learned before build versus during pilot or rollout?
  • Which methods are realistic given timeline and access constraints?
